Transaction dd70ca43b5f6faebb18116546c6c7cc56bf59d214c8a5ec2c34b93c56397d1c8

2 Input
1 Outputs
  • dd70ca43b5f6faebb18116546c6c7cc56bf59d214c8a5ec2c34b93c56397d1c8:0
  • value  5175558
    address  3LcibkfxFdi567CHaiXZz3p2QEbrLyyUBC